Fuel information
■Gasoline quality
In very few cases, driveability problems may be caused by the brand of gaso-
line you are using. If driveability problems persist, try changing the brand of
gasoline. If this does not correct the problem, consult your Toyota dealer.
■If your engine knocks
●Consult your Toyota dealer.
●You may occasionally notice light knocking for a short time while accelerat-
ing or driving uphill. This is normal and there is no need for concern.
■Gasoline quality standards
●Automotive manufacturers in the U.S.A., Europe and Japan have developed
a specification for fuel quality called the World-Wide Fuel Charter (WWFC),
which is expected to be applied worldwide.
●The WWFC consists of four categories that are based on required emission
levels. In the U.S., category 4 has been adopted.
●The WWFC improves air quality by lowering emissions in vehicle fleets, and
improves customer satisfaction through better performance.
■Recommendation of the use of gasoline containing detergent additives
●Toyota recommends the use of gasoline that contains detergent additives to
avoid the build-up of engine deposits.
●All gasoline sold in the U.S.A. contains minimum detergent additives to
clean and/or keep clean intake systems, per EPA’s lowest additives concen-
tration program.
●Toyota strongly recommends the use of Top Tier Detergent Gasoline. For
more information on Top Tier Detergent Gasoline and a list of marketers,
please go to the official website www.toptiergas.com.
You must only use unleaded gasoline in your vehicle.
Select octane rating 87 (Research Octane Number 91) or higher.
Use of unleaded gasoline with an octane rating lower than 87
may result in engine knocking. Persistent knocking can lead to
engine damage.
At minimum, the gasoline you use should meet the specifications of
ASTM D4814 in the U.S.A..

■Recommendation of the use of low emissions gasoline
Gasoline containing oxygenates such as ethers and ethanol, as well as refor-
mulated gasoline are available in some cities. These fuels are typically
acceptable for use, providing they meet other fuel requirements.
Toyota recommends these fuels, since the formulations allow for reduced
vehicle emissions.
■Non-recommendation of the use of blended gasoline
●If you use gasohol in your vehicle, be sure that it has an octane rating no
lower than 87.
●Toyota does not recommend the use of gasoline containing methanol.
■Non-recommendation of the use of gasoline containing MMT
Some gasoline contains an octane enhancing additive called MMT
(Methylcyclopentadienyl Manganese Tricarbonyl).
Toyota does not recommend the use of gasoline that contains MMT. If fuel
containing MMT is used, your emission control system may be adversely
affected.
The malfunction indicator lamp on the instrument cluster may come on. If this
happens, contact your Toyota dealer for service. ●Use only gasoline containing up to 15%
ethanol.

NOTICE
■Notice on fuel quality
●Do not use improper fuels. If improper fuels are used, the engine will be
damaged.
●Do not use leaded gasoline.
Leaded gasoline can cause damage to your vehicle’s three-way catalytic
converters causing the emission control system to malfunction.
●Do not use gasohol other than the type previously stated.
Other gasohol may cause fuel system damage or vehicle performance
problems.
●Using unleaded gasoline with an octane number or rating lower than the
level previously stated will cause persistent heavy knocking.
At worst, this will lead to engine damage.
■Fuel-related poor driveability
If poor driveability (poor hot starting, vaporization, engine knocking, etc.) is
encountered after using a different type of fuel, discontinue the use of that
type of fuel.
■When refueling with gasohol
Take care not to spill gasohol. It can damage your vehicle’s paint.

Tire ply composition and materials
Plies are layers of rubber-coated parallel cords. Cords are the strands
which form the plies in a tire.
Summer tires or all season tires (P. 447)
An all season tire has “M+S” on the sidewall. A tire not marked “M+S” is a
summer tire.
Radial tires or bias-ply tires
A radial tire has “RADIAL” on the sidewall. A tire not marked “RADIAL” is a
bias-ply tire.
TUBELESS or TUBE TYPE
A tubeless tire does not have a tube and air is directly put into the tire. A
tube type tire has a tube inside the tire and the tube maintains the air pres-
sure.
Load limit at maximum cold tire inflation pressure (P. 446)
Maximum cold tire inflation pressure (P. 559)
This means the pressure to which a tire may be inflated.
Uniform tire quality grading
For details, see “Uniform Tire Quality Grading” that follows.
“TEMPORARY USE ONLY”
A compact spare tire is identified by the phrase “TEMPORARY USE
ONLY” molded on its sidewall. This tire is designed for temporary emer-
gency use only.

This information has been prepared in accordance with regulations
issued by the National Highway Traffic Safety Administration of the
U.S. Department of Transportation.
It provides the purchasers and/or prospective purchasers of Toyota
vehicles with information on uniform tire quality grading.
Your Toyota dealer will help answer any questions you may have as you
read this information.
■
DOT quality grades
All passenger vehicle tires must conform to Federal Safety Require-
ments in addition to these grades. Quality grades can be found
where applicable on the tire sidewall between tread shoulder and
maximum section width.
For example: Treadwear 200 Traction AA Temperature A

■Treadwear
The treadwear grade is a comparative rating based on the wear
rate of the tire when tested under controlled conditions on a speci-
fied government test course.
For example, a tire graded 150 would wear one and a half (1 - 1/2) times
as well on the government course as a tire graded 100.
The relative performance of tires depends upon the actual conditions of
their use. Performance may differ significantly from the norm due to
variations in driving habits, service practices and differences in road
characteristics and climate.
■
Traction AA, A, B, C
The traction grades, from highest to lowest, are AA, A, B and C,
and they represent the tire’s ability to stop on wet pavement as
measured under controlled conditions on specified government test
surfaces of asphalt and concrete.
A tire marked C may have poor traction performance.
Warning: The traction grade assigned to this tire is based on braking
(straight ahead) traction tests and does not include cornering (turning)
traction.
■
Temperature A, B, C
The temperature grades are A (the highest), B, and C, representing
the tire’s resistance to the generation of heat and its ability to dissi-
pate heat when tested under controlled conditions on a specified
indoor laboratory test wheel.
Sustained high temperature can cause the material of the tire to degen-
erate and reduce tire life, and excessive temperature can lead to sud-
den tire failure.
Grade C corresponds to a level of performance which all passenger car
tires must meet under the Federal Motor Vehicle Safety Standard No.
109.
Grades B and A represent higher levels of performance on the labora-
tory test wheel than the minimum required by law.
Warning: The temperature grades of a tire assume that it is properly
inflated and not overloaded.
Excessive speed, underinflation, or excessive loading, either separately
or in combination, can cause heat buildup and possible tire failure.
